sql >> Database >  >> NoSQL >> Redis

Houd Redis-gegevens in leven tussen docker-compose omlaag en omhoog in Docker-container

U hoeft alleen een benoemd volume voor Redis-gegevens toe te voegen naast de postgres_data :

volumes:
    postgres_data:
    redis_data:

Wijzig vervolgens het hostpad naar het genoemde volume:

  redis:
    ...
    volumes:
        - redis_data:/data

Als Redis gegevens heeft opgeslagen met het hostpad, dan zal het bovenstaande voor u werken. Ik vermeld dat omdat je Redis moet configureren om permanente opslag in te schakelen (zie Redis Docker Hub-pagina https://hub.docker.com/_/redis).

Pas op, docker-compose down -v . uitvoeren zal ook volumes vernietigen.




  1. mongodb aggregatie sorteren

  2. Een overzicht van operationele databaserapportage in ClusterControl

  3. Hoe gebruik ik Node.js-clusters met mijn eenvoudige Express-app?

  4. Bereken het gemiddelde van velden in ingesloten documenten/array